Here are the details:&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;em&gt;Holiday Gift Exchange&lt;/em&gt; – For those of you who haven't played before, all gifts are placed on the counter, and each member chooses a number. When your number is called, it's your turn to choose a gift from the pile. But wait…there's a twist! You have the option of stealing away another member's gift instead of choosing your own. It's a lot of fun watching coveted gifts make their rounds across the room. Don't worry though, everyone leaves with a gift!&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The gift: Gifts should be inexpensive – about $10 to $15.00. If you're bringing a gift with a holiday theme, please wrap in holiday paper. This way, those ladies who don't celebrate a certain holiday won't pick an unwanted gift. If your gift doesn't have a holiday theme, it can be wrapped in generic wrapping.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;em&gt;Cookie Exchange&lt;/em&gt; – Those who are interested can take part in a cookie exchange. Here's how it works: Everyone who participates should bring in 6 packages filled with 6 cookies each. Your six packages will be exchanged for six other packages. Everyone will go home with 36 cookies. This isn't mandatory, but it's fun!&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;em&gt;Food&lt;/em&gt; - Do you have a special treat you'd like to share?
